
Many infrastructure expertise groups consider they’ve mastered infrastructure automation, however the knowledge tells a special story. We commissioned a survey to discover the state of infrastructure automation, and this analysis uncovered a stark hole between notion and actuality. Whereas 45% of organizations consider they’ve achieved a excessive stage of infrastructure automation, solely 14% exhibit the habits and expertise patterns of infrastructure automation excellence.
This is without doubt one of the illuminating findings of our survey of 413 infrastructure instrument buy decision-makers and influencers, performed by Panterra. Full outcomes are detailed in “The State of Infrastructure Automation” report, out there for obtain.

What Infrastructure Automation Leaders Do That Others Don’t
The report uncovered clear patterns among the many most automation-mature organizations—those that have mastered the Velocity-Management Paradox:
- Developer Self-Service with Guardrails: Leaders empower builders to deploy infrastructure independently whereas embedding safeguards. Leaders have constructed high-velocity environments the place builders can deal with constructing slightly than troubleshooting: 61% of Leaders have streamlined workflows and decreased friction, in comparison with 8% of corporations who’re categorized as simply getting began with Infrastructure Automation.
- Platform Engineering for Consistency: Leaders are 5 instances extra more likely to have carried out a platform engineering workforce than their less-advanced friends: 29% of Leaders have carried out platform groups in comparison with simply 7% of complete respondents. Leaders don’t depend on ad-hoc automation; they set up devoted platform groups to create standardized workflows and reusable templates, guaranteeing consistency throughout environments.
- Safety as a Constructed-In Basis: Greater than half (58%) of Leaders have lower safety incidents, and 56% report fewer compliance violations versus 36% of complete respondents. Leaders combine automated safety checks, coverage enforcement, and drift detection into each stage of their automation pipeline. Safety will not be an afterthought; it’s a steady, proactive course of.
- Price Optimization as a Precedence: Leaders view value effectivity as important to enterprise success: 51% of Leaders cite value financial savings & ROI as a prime enterprise metric, in comparison with 41% of respondents general. By leveraging automated value estimation and coverage enforcement to curb overprovisioning and stop waste, 47% of Leaders have efficiently decreased infrastructure prices, in comparison with 32% of all respondents.
- Orchestration Over Automation: Essentially the most superior groups transcend instrument adoption. They orchestrate your entire infrastructure lifecycle—provisioning, configuration, safety, and governance—right into a unified, automated pipeline. This end-to-end orchestration is what drives true automation maturity and outcomes like these: Main corporations are twice as more likely to get infrastructure deployments proper on the primary attempt, 4 instances extra more likely to provision new assets in 4 hours or much less, and 5 instances extra more likely to deploy modifications in manufacturing day by day or a number of instances a day. In distinction, over 50% of organizations take per week or extra to deploy infrastructure modifications in manufacturing, and 43% must rerun their infrastructure deployments greater than 4 instances to get it proper.

Methods to Obtain Infrastructure Automation Excellence
Right here’s the perfect information that our examine reveals: Any group can obtain infrastructure automation excellence by adopting a deliberate, strategic method. Endeavor to do these 5 issues:
- Benchmark Your Maturity: Start with an sincere evaluation. Use out there self-assessment instruments to know the place you stand on the automation maturity curve. Recognizing gaps is step one towards enchancment.
- Shift Left on Safety & Compliance: Combine safety and compliance checks early in your infrastructure planning and lifecycle. Automated validation processes stop points from reaching manufacturing, decreasing threat and minimizing downtime.
- Stability Velocity with Governance: Foster a tradition the place velocity and safety should not competing priorities however complementary targets. Empower builders by way of self-service whereas establishing clear insurance policies and automatic guardrails.
- Standardize By means of Platform Engineering: Centralize automation efforts beneath a platform workforce that aligns instruments, workflows, and finest practices throughout the group. This workforce ought to function an enabler, not a gatekeeper.
- Measure What Issues: Transfer past deployment velocity as the only metric. Monitor value effectivity, safety incidents, and infrastructure stability. A balanced scorecard method fosters sustainable automation progress.
